Subject: DR drill — DocLintra restore step

Hi, as part of Thursday's disaster-recovery drill we'll rebuild the DocLintra documentation linter from the cold backup and re-run it against the Harwick release notes. Timing should not affect the release cut. For the restore step, enter the recovery passphrase below.

unlock words, yawig-kagef: gordor-holvan-ulaael-pramir-ulaiel-tamdor

## Configuration

Sproutly, our little plant-watering scheduler, reads everything from a single `.env` file — no YAML rabbit holes, promise. You'll set the watering window, the pump relay pin, and the timezone for the greenhouse in Fernbeck. Defaults are sane: twice daily, 30-second bursts. Reviewers, please check that nothing here leaks into the client bundle; only the server should see these values. The scheduler also talks to our weather relay to skip rainy days, which requires this credential line:

sealed setting: ARCHIVE_KEY3=202

Subject: Key rotation for InvoiceForge renderer

Welcome, new folks. Every quarter we rotate the credential the Pellworth PDF invoice renderer uses to call our internal asset service, Vaultline. The old key stops working Friday at noon. Update your local .env and the staging config before then, and verify a test invoice renders with the new embedded fonts. For convenience, the freshly issued key is included here.

app token of bagef-bageg = kto11_vuwA0uhrEMg

## SeatScape Environments

Welcome aboard! SeatScape is the seat-map renderer behind the Pellworth Playhouse booking flow. We run three environments: dev (churns constantly, don't trust it), staging (mirrors the Playhouse's real auditorium layouts), and prod (the one angry patrons see). Each environment has its own renderer pool and tile cache, so cross-environment testing won't tell you much. Deploys go through Larkin, our release tool — ask Priya on the platform team for access. The staging config is as follows.

service settings:
[casax]
port = 6379
team = rusir
host = casax.zemvarhq.corp
region = outer-4
access_code = ac_9808ce
timeout_ms = 1500